A dental sealant is a thin, protective coating applied directly to the chewing surfaces of the back teeth, the molars and premolars, where cavities are most likely to develop. The procedure is quick, completely painless, and requires no drilling or anesthesia. Yet its impact on long-term oral health can be significant.

What Are Dental Sealants Made Of?
Dental sealants are typically made from a safe, tooth-colored plastic resin material that bonds directly to the enamel of the tooth. Once applied and hardened, the sealant forms a durable, protective shield over the chewing surface, flowing into and sealing every groove and pit where cavities typically begin.
Modern dental sealants are:
- BPA-free — safe for children and adults
- Durable — can last several years with proper care
- Proven effective — backed by decades of clinical research demonstrating significant reduction in cavity rates
How Long Do Dental Sealants Last?
With proper care, dental sealants can last anywhere from five to ten years, sometimes longer. At every routine dental visit, Dr. Philip or Dr. Thomas will check the condition of existing sealants and determine whether any need to be touched up or reapplied.
Sealants can chip or wear down over time, particularly in patients who grind their teeth or chew on hard objects. However, even a partially worn sealant continues to offer meaningful protection compared to an unsealed tooth. Reapplication is quick, simple, and just as painless as the original procedure.
